The IMA Early Career Mathematicians’ Autumn Conference 2020 was aimed at mathematicians early in their career, in academia and industry, students of mathematical sciences, as well as those with an interest in the subject. In 2020 this event was held virtually on 24-25 October.

Dr Magda Carr (Newcastle University) was one of the Invited Speakers at this Conference and provided a talk on 'Mathematical and Experimental Modelling of Internal Solitary Waves'
